Fed Comments Weigh Heavily on Cryptocurrency Market Confidence
The cryptocurrency market has shown a lack of strength and confidence in recent moves due to the Federal Reserve's comments following its decision to keep interest rates unchanged at 3.75%. The central bank noted that inflation remains elevated, far from its target of 2%, which may lead to additional steps to control it.
The Fed's dot plot showed a higher median rate for 2026, now at 3.8%, compared to 3.4% in March, and revised inflation expectations upwards. This shift has raised concerns about interest rate increases in the US, which can create an environment of increased borrowing costs and reduced market liquidity.
This scenario is unfavorable for cryptocurrency market confidence in the short term, as higher interest rates may reduce appetite for risk assets like cryptocurrencies. The inverse correlation between the DXY dollar index and Bitcoin price action has also strengthened, suggesting that market participants are shifting towards more stable assets.
